From e87c6a4d54c51aafe6f33caaf554b75044e82774 Mon Sep 17 00:00:00 2001 From: Elias Steurer Date: Sat, 13 Nov 2021 14:13:13 +0100 Subject: [PATCH] Check if we have a connection before setting anything --- ScreenPlay/src/screenplaywallpaper.cpp |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/ScreenPlay/src/screenplaywallpaper.cpp b/ScreenPlay/src/screenplaywallpaper.cpp index 389a1ec9..3434554b 100644 --- a/ScreenPlay/src/screenplaywallpaper.cpp +++ b/ScreenPlay/src/screenplaywallpaper.cpp @@ -174,6 +174,11 @@ void ScreenPlayWallpaper::processError(QProcess::ProcessError error) */ bool ScreenPlayWallpaper::setWallpaperValue(const QString& key, const QString& value, const bool save) { + if (!m_connection) { + qWarning() << "Cannot set value for unconnected wallpaper!"; + return false; + } + QJsonObject obj; obj.insert(key, value);